Your Committee on Veterans, Military, & International Affairs, & Culture and the Arts, to which was referred H.B. No. 1076 entitled:
"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O TUITION WAIVERS,"
begs leave to report as follows:
Your Committee finds that the death or total disability of a family member in the armed forces can place immense financial challenges on a family. This measure will help reduce those financial challenges by removing the barrier of costly higher education tuition payments for spouses and children of severely injured or deceased veterans.
As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Veterans, Military, & International Affairs, & Culture and the Arts that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 1076 and recommends that it pass Second Reading and be referred to the Committee on Higher Education.
